Output 2857339b854f83da62f75ad8286400cbef6b6415759cad3a039f0e65613c29ff:3

value
10629711020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f656fdedc9f92344a5e82b6721c84556338fbd OP_EQUALVERIFY OP_CHECKSIG
address
1DrLhr6XVTYCicTFSjYUrqjP7bC9Mzk6WV
transaction
2857339b854f83da62f75ad8286400cbef6b6415759cad3a039f0e65613c29ff
spent
true